The Islamic Cultural Centre of Ireland organized a prize-giving ceremony awarded to the winners of different competitions held during the Ramadan 2015-1436. The event took place on Saturday 12 September 2015 at 3pm in ICCI Multipurpose hall.  Families gathered to celebrate and to honour fantastic achievement of their children.

There were 173 participants coming from all over Ireland, competing with each other in the Quranic competition spread across the ten levels: half juza, 1juza, 2 juza, 3 juza, 4 juza, 5 juza, quarter of the Qur'an, one third of the Qur'an, half of the Qur'an and the whole of Qur'an.

The other competitions composed of Sira competition and research competition. These competitions had approximately thirty participants.

As for the Sira competition, for the third time it was organized based on the Arraheeq Almakhtoom book, which has been awarded the first prize by the Muslim World League,  at the first Islamic Conference on Seerah, hence in sha’a Allah, we shall continue to organize the competition of Sira of the Prophet Mohammad p.b.u.h. consistently.

Regarding the Research competition, it has covered the following sections:

  1. The Methodology of Da’wa in Sira,
  2. Human Values in Sira,
  3. The Fiqh of context in Sira,
  4. Muslim-non Muslim relations in Sira,
  5. How can we apply lessons of Sira in respect of contemporary challenges?
